一种用于外场试验的传感器靶标设计与优化

Design and Optimization of a Sensor Target for Field Experiments

Abstract

Due to the fact that field tests are often conducted in uninhabited desert and Gobi areas,the testing and measuring equipment during the tests must face extreme harsh environments such as high temperatures and sandstorms.In order to further improve the adaptability of the photoelectric sensor target to the field high-tem-perature environment,an optimized design is carried out in terms of the internal structure,circuit,reliability re-dundancy and mechanically assisted heat dissipation of the target,and a photoelectric sensor target suitable for the high-temperature test environment in the field is developed,which can realize the rapid acquisition of the number of laser irradiation target rings,meet the needs of UAV flight and laser-guided strike training tasks,and effectively improve the operator's ability to use UAV-based/vehicle-mounted laser irradiation for continuous ir-radiation,stable tracking and accurate guidance and positioning.It has a good application prospect.
